#859389 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#859389 is composed of 52.2% red, 57.6%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.8%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 137.1 degrees, a saturation of 6.1% and a lightness of 54.9%. #859389 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0b2713.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#859389

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030303 is the darkest color, while #f7f8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#859389

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#859389 is the less saturated color, while #1bfd5c is the most saturated one.
